Friendly match, 24. March 2023

Friendly win over Heidenheim

VfB took advantage of the international break to play a friendly against 1. FC Heidenheim, which they won 2-0 at the Robert-Schlienz-Stadion in front of around 1,000 fans.

Following a goalless first half, VfB took the lead soon after the restart through a Norman Theuerkauf own goal (49'), with Waldemar Anton doubling the advantage a short while later with a long-range drive (55'). Both teams used the remainder of the match to give game time to other players. There were no further chances of note, leaving VfB with a 2-0 victory.

Bruno Labbadia, VfB head coach: "We trained well this week and wanted to approach the match against Heidenheim as if it were a competitive fixture. In the first half we weren't able to capitalise on our attacks. We had situations where we won the ball well and should have done more with it. That's all that was lacking in the first 45 minutes. After the break we managed to get our goals."
